2012 impala 100,000 mile tune up

my 2012 ltz just rolled 100k now it is time to change the trans fluid is there a drain plug i have read there in no serviceable filter and how much dex 6 does it take?

and also time for spark plugs how do the #3 and #5 come out in back can you turn the coils to get past the upper intake or does it have to come off?

Re: 2012 impala 100,000 mile tune up

update:had my local favorite mechanic shop do the transmission fluid and it was written up for 5qts of dex 6.it does have a drain plug and no filter. still wating on the plugs watched a video where a guy did get them changed without removing the upper intake and it didn't look too bad to do
